WebStimulants increase blood flow, which can contribute to inflammation in those neck and jaw tissues which can cause tinnitus. Stimulants stimulate the nervous system. Anxiety and stress can be easier to trigger while taking stimulants, and stress is a known contributor to tinnitus. Stimulants are also known to contribute to muscle tension.
